Clock Tower & Geni Tzami

The Clock Tower in Komotini was built under the reign of Sultan Hamid II and it is next to the Yeni Mosque (Yeni Cami) in the old market of Komotini. The famous Yeni Mosque was built in 1586 by the chief of the financial department of the Ottoman Empire Ekmektsi Ahmet Pasha. The mosque is open to visitors. Nearby you can see the tin mill workshops (aka as teneketzidika or τενεκετζίδικα in Greek).

Cave of the Cyclop Polyphemus

In the prefecture of Rhodope, about 30 km. South of Komotini, between Proskynites village and Maronia village, at Mount Ismaros, in the area known as "Koufou to Plai" you can find the cave of Maronia which is rich in stalactites and stalagmites.

The reference to Kikones and Maronas, priest of Apollo in Ismaros city in the Odyssey, led us to believe there is a link between the cave and the incidence of  blindness of the giant Polyphemus by Odysseus (i352-452). Therefore, the cave is known as the cave of the Cyclop Polyphemus.
